Don't create deployment when changing transport
Earlier when changing software config transport we used to
create a dummy deployment to push the metadata. However
this would not work with convergence as we take
resource lock for the update which updates the config
transport (another engine would try to update the resource
metadata for deployment when one engine has locked it).
Currently it works when updating transport as we ignore
the error in creating dummy deployment, but if there are
any new depoyments for the server they would fail.
We don't need to push the metadata as it would be pushed
when the there is a new/updated deployment.
Few additional changes in the patch:
- We don't need to ignore the error as servers are now
not replaced if the resource is in ERROR when nova server
is good/ACTIVE.
- Delete the existing tempurls and zaqar queues when
changing transport.
